As a CBRE HVAC Mobile Engineer, you will operate, inspect, and maintain mechanical and electrical equipment for commercial HVAC systems in multiple assigned facilities. This job is part of the Engineering and Technical Services job function. They are responsible for providing support, preventive maintenance, and repairs on equipment and systems. What youu2019ll do u00b7 Provide formal supervision to employees. Monitor the training and development of staff. Conduct performance evaluations and coaching. Oversee the recruiting and hiring of new employees. u00b7 Coordinate and manage the team's daily activities. Establish work schedules, assign tasks, and cross-train staff. Set and track staff and department deadlines. Mentor and coach as needed. u00b7 Maintain, operate, and repair HVAC systems and associated equipment, electrical distribution equipment, plumbing systems, etc. u00b7 Inspect building HVAC and plumbing systems to ensure operation of equipment is within design capabilities and achieves environmental conditions. u00b7 Perform assigned repairs, emergency, and preventive maintenance. Complete maintenance and repair records as required. u00b7 Review historical maintenance records to develop proactive inspection, testing and preventive maintenance schedule. u00b7 Respond quickly to emergency situations, summoning additional assistance as needed. u00b7 Lead by example and model behaviors that are consistent with CBRE RISE values. Influence parties of shared interests to reach an agreement. u00b7 Apply knowledge of own subject area and how own subject area integrates with others to achieve team and departmental objectives. u00b7 Identify, solve, and resolve day-to-day and moderately complex issues which may or may not be evident in existing systems and processes.
